Description
Imaginative & Innovative Activities That Meet Curriculum Expectations! Students will become familiar with the six animal groups and the animals within each group. They will classify animals, understand the major physical characteristics and behavioral characteristics that enable animals to survive. Gain an understanding of metamorphosis and become familiar with the lifecycles of various animals and be able to compare the lifecycles of different animals whether they are similar or dissimilar. They will learn to appreciate the many ways in which humans affect other animals and how animals adapt to different environment conditions. 40 activities, 96 pages.
